General annotation (Comments)

Function

Converts N-acetylmannosamine-6-phosphate (ManNAc-6-P) to N-acetylglucosamine-6-phosphate (GlcNAc-6-P) Potential. HAMAP MF_01235

Catalytic activity

N-acyl-D-glucosamine 6-phosphate = N-acyl-D-mannosamine 6-phosphate. HAMAP MF_01235

Pathway

Amino-sugar metabolism; N-acetylneuraminate degradation; D-fructose 6-phosphate from N-acetylneuraminate: step 3/5. HAMAP MF_01235

Sequence similarities

Belongs to the nanE family.
